👕 What Is a Clothing Swap and Why Host One?
A clothing swap event allows participants to exchange gently used clothes with others, encouraging sustainability and reducing textile waste. In 2025, these events are especially popular among Gen Z and millennials who value affordability and eco-friendly alternatives.
Choosing the Right Venue and Date
Selecting a convenient, accessible venue ensures your swap event is well-attended. Local libraries, parks, schools, or community centers often offer free or low-cost event spaces.
🎯 Pro Tip: Host your event near the start of a season (e.g., spring or fall) when people want to refresh their wardrobes.

🎽 Clothing Categories, Display, and Setup
Organize tables by type: men’s, women’s, kids’, accessories, shoes. Provide mirrors and clean changing areas. Label racks and use eco signage to keep the vibe sustainable.
🧺 Swap Guidelines Example:
- Only clean, gently worn clothes are accepted
- Maximum 10 items per person
- Bring your bag
- No price tags—everything is free to exchange!

❓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
❓ What is a clothing swap event?
A clothing swap is a community event where people bring gently used clothes and exchange them for free.
❓ How do I make sure people show up?
Use Eventbrite, social media, and community groups to promote your event with clear details and visuals.
❓ What should I do with leftover clothing?
Donate unswapped items to local shelters or thrift stores like Goodwill or The Salvation Army.
❓ Can I host this indoors or outdoors?
Yes! Outdoor events work great in warmer seasons; indoor venues are best for weather-proof setups.
